Question 1
Importance of Intelligence Requirements to Indicators
Principally, intelligence requirements help outline priorities and provide a rationale
for any intelligence activities to be executed. Therefore, it affects indicators and the ensuing
data collection plan to drive the process. The relationship between indicators and intelligence
requirements is that the former provides information on the various means by which the
intelligence requirements can be met and adequately satisfied, and the type of outcome and
coverage expected and required (Dunleigh, 1994). Indicators also help assign a probability to
various events, helping to outline which intelligence requirements should be addressed first.
As such, both indicators and intelligence requirements work to support effective decisionmaking in terms of events' execution and planning.
Importance to Collection Plans
Intelligence requirements add detailed information that fosters creating a collection
plan that provides adequate guidance to analysts on the best action course (Bundy, 1995).
